**Putting It Together – Practice Game** In this session, students will apply their knowledge of piece movements and basic rules by playing practice games against each other, reinforcing what they’ve learned so far. **Review and Recap** This session will serve as a review of everything covered in the previous sessions. Students will discuss their experiences and clarify any misunderstandings about the rules and piece movements. **Puzzle Session** Students will engage in solving chess puzzles that reinforce the tactics they have learned. This session will focus on recognizing patterns and applying strategies in practical scenarios. **Game Review** Students will review their practice games, discussing key moves and strategies used. They will reflect on what worked well and what could be improved in their gameplay. **Surprise Test** This session will include a short test to assess students' understanding of the chessboard, piece movements, and basic rules. The results will help identify areas for further review. **Introduction to Basic Tactics** In this session, students will be introduced to the concept of tactics in chess, learning about their importance and how they can influence the outcome of a game. **Forks** Students will learn about the tactical motif of the fork, where one piece simultaneously attacks two or more enemy pieces. They will practice identifying and executing forks in games. **Pins** This session will cover the tactic of the pin, where a piece cannot move without exposing a more valuable piece behind it. Students will practice recognizing and utilizing pins. **Skewers** Students will learn about skewers, a tactic that forces an opponent's more valuable piece to move, exposing a less valuable one behind it. They will practice applying this tactic. **Combining Tactics** In this session, students will learn how to combine different tactics, such as forks, pins, and skewers, to create powerful attacking opportunities. They will practice these combinations in exercises. **Puzzle Session** Another session of puzzle-solving will be held, this time focusing on more complex tactics involving multiple pieces. Students will develop their problem-solving skills. **Game Review** Students will analyze their recent games and puzzle exercises, discussing the tactics used and identifying areas for improvement. This reflective practice helps solidify learning.

Do I need to have completed Part 1 to join this course?
It is recommended to complete Part 1, but if you understand basic chess concepts, you can start with Part 2.
Will I learn about specific opening systems in this part?
Yes, you will be introduced to common opening strategies and how to apply them effectively.
Will there be a focus on tactical puzzles?
Yes, you will practice with tactical puzzles designed to improve your recognition of key patterns.
What endgame positions will we cover?
We will cover king and pawn endgames, as well as some minor piece endgames
Can I start playing in tournaments after this part?
After Part 2, you will have the foundational skills to start participating in beginner-level chess tournaments and casual competitive play.
